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yi will visit New Delhi next week and meet with India’s National Security Adviser Ajit Doval, two anonymous sources informed Reuters about visit, APA reports.
The sources noted that the parties will discuss disputed areas along the border region.
Additionally,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i is set to travel to China at the end of this month to participate in the Shanghai Cooperation Organization summit.
This will mark the first visit by an Indian Prime Minister to China in the past seven years.
